WebHidrocystoma is a translucent jelly-like cyst arising on an eyelid. It is also known as cystadenoma, Moll gland cyst, and sudoriferous cyst. The common solitary translucent eyelid cyst is an apocrine hidrocystoma. Multiple cysts on the lower eyelid are eccrine hidrocystomas. Squamous papilloma – Squamous papilloma is the most common benign tumor of the eyelid. It’s also known as an acrochordon or a skin tag. The lesion is soft, smooth, round and attached by a “stalk” to the eyelid.
